qapi: Fix missing 'if' checks in struct, union, alternate 'data'

Commit 87adbbffd4..3e270dcacc "qapi: Add 'if' to (implicit
struct|union|alternate) members" (v4.0.0) neglected test coverage, and
promptly failed to check the conditions.  Review fail.

Recent commit "tests/qapi-schema: Demonstrate insufficient 'if'
checking" added test coverage, demonstrating the bug.  Fix it by add
the missing check_if().
